  11. 1/4 cup salt 1/2 cup baking soda Pour 1 cup white vinegar into something microwave safe and heat it up by microwaving in 30 second intervals until it's Very Hot. Mix in large cup. Spoon the mixture into the drain you want to clean. Be patient, you want as much powder as possible to go down into where the clog is. Carefully pour the hot vinegar into the drain after the powder. Admire the fizzy fountain attempts. Leave the whole thing alone for a minimum of 15 minutes. Carefully pour boiling hot water into the drain to rinse everything out.
